If you’re familiar with mixing monitors on the x32, it might help to think of it like this:
Pressing the “MIX” button on a channel on the GLD is equivalent to selecting a channel and pressing the Sends-on-Faders button on the x32: the aux master faders now represent the “MIXed” channel’s send levels to those auxes: one channel to many mixes.
Pressing the “MIX” button on an aux master on the GLD is equivalent to selecting a mixbus and pressing the Sends-on-Faders button on the x32: the channel faders now represent the channels’ send levels to the “MIXed” Aux: many channels to one mix.
For your keyboard example you can do one of 2 things:
Find the keyboard channel, press the “Mix” button above it, find the Keyboard IEM master fader and raise it.
-or-
Find the Keyboard IEM master, press the “Mix” button above it, find the keyboard channel fader and raise it.
